Sensing the need for such a facility, [3] work on the University Convocation Complex commenced on 7 November 1981 when the foundation stone of the multi-Crore project was laid by then Chief Minister of Jammu & Kashmir, Sheikh Mohammad Abdullah. Soon after, the construction work remained suspended for several years due to technical reasons.
Internationally, the University of Kashmir was ranked 451–500 in Asia in the QS World University Rankings for 2023. [21] In India, the QS World University Rankings ranked the University of Kashmir 56–60 and the National Institutional Ranking Framework (NIRF) ranked it 69th overall and 45th among universities in 2024. Jammu and Kashmir (J&K) Union Territory of India has 7 Institutes of National Importance, 11 universities (2 central and 9 state universities), 4 research institutes, 11 medical colleges, at least 14 engineering colleges, and many other prominent institutes in 2024.
